Condividi tramite


La classe oggetto di base e l'ereditarietà

Aggiornamento: novembre 2007

Quasi tutte le operazioni eseguite in Visual Basic implicano l'utilizzo di oggetti, comprese alcune entità che normalmente non vengono considerate oggetti, come le stringhe e i valori integer. Tutti gli oggetti di Visual Basic sono derivati da una classe di base chiamata System.Object da cui ereditano metodi. La classe System.Object rappresenta una classe di base comune per tutti gli oggetti inclusi in .NET Framework, in grado di garantire l'interoperabilità degli oggetti sviluppati utilizzando Visual Studio. Nuove classi ereditano in modo implicito la classe System.Object e non è mai necessario indicarla in modo esplicito in un'istruzione Inherits.

Tra i metodi che gli oggetti ereditano da System.Object, uno dei più utili è GetType, che consente di ottenere il tipo esatto dell'oggetto corrente.

Vedere anche

Concetti

Override di proprietà e metodi

Nozioni fondamentali sull'ereditarietà

Riferimenti

Object

GetType